Transaction 183c5b00162e495225c304ab78110f83d4f58f1aacda6c5fd7d382db569f66b1
1 Input
1 Output
-
183c5b00162e495225c304ab78110f83d4f58f1aacda6c5fd7d382db569f66b1:0
- value
- 315989
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 c23dc9e6f46bd00a95f3bc1208c8cc65be018344 OP_EQUAL
- address
- 3KQ52upyU8Pf623EAfdrkexUdvKm162Kdj